Could you please help me? I need to force L4Linux to use Flips’ TCP/IP stack instead of internal Linux’s TCP/IP implementation. Is it possible to do with minor effort?
No, at least it isn't just a configure issue. You need some kind of in- L4Linux-kernel TCP/IP stub talking to Flips via IPC. This stub is at least missing. Well, we have a library that provides a POSIX socket interface (talking via IPC to Flips) designed for L4 user applications. Probably such a kernel stub can reuse it. However some engineering effort in L4Linux would be required ...

I guess mentioned library is not part of FLIPS package as I can't see corresponding header file in "./l4/pkg/flips/include/". Could you please tell me where is this library in the SVN repository? Are there any particular examples that demonstrate how to use the library?
l4/pkg/flips/examples/mini_http is a simple example using the POSIX socket functions. In the Makefile you can see all libs that are required. The used libraries in the Makefile are indeed not part of FLIPS, they are part of l4/pkg/l4vfs.
